WebJul 3, 2013 · Chlorophenols are readily absorbed by fermentors and hoses and passed on to the beer as it is being transferred, so these materials should be thoroughly rinsed and aerated after contact with sanitizers. WebChlorophenols are a group of man-made chemicals. There are different types of chlorophenol chemicals. Most chlorophenols are solid at room temperature. They have a strong taste and smell like medicine. Small amounts can be tasted in water. Chlorophenols are used in a number of industries and products. They can be used for making pesticides ...
